Picking the Right Dumpster Size

Choosing the correct bin size is key. Surrey dumpster companies usually offer 10-yard to 40-yard roll-off bins.

  • 10-Yard Dumpster – Small remodels or yard cleanups.
  • 20-Yard Dumpster – Most popular choice for medium projects.
  • 30-Yard Dumpster – Great for larger home renovations or contractor jobs.
  • 40-Yard Dumpster – Large construction sites and demolitions.

Tip: If unsure, go bigger. It’s more cost-effective than renting a second bin.

What Can You Put in a Dumpster in Surrey?

Surrey follows strict rules on what goes into a dumpster.

Accepted Waste:

  • Drywall, flooring, and lumber
  • Roofing shingles
  • Concrete, asphalt, and bricks
  • Household junk and furniture
  • Scrap metals

Not Allowed:

  • Hazardous waste (paint, solvents, chemicals)
  • Asbestos materials
  • Electronics and appliances with refrigerants
  • Tires and batteries

How Much Does a Dumpster Rental Cost in Surrey?

The cost of a dumpster rental in Surrey depends on:

  • Bin Size – Bigger bins cost more.
  • Rental Time – Most include 7–10 days; extra fees for longer.
  • Material Weight – Heavy waste like concrete or soil may raise prices.
  • Location – Delivery distance within Surrey can affect cost.

Average Price Range in Surrey:

  • 10-yard: $300–$450
  • 20-yard: $400–$550
  • 30-yard: $500–$700
  • 40-yard: $600–$800

Do You Need a Permit for a Dumpster in Surrey?

  • Private Driveway or Property – Usually no permit needed.
  • Street or Sidewalk Placement – City of Surrey permit required.
  • Strata or HOA Properties – Check local rules.

Best Practices for Using a Dumpster

To make the most of your rental:

  1. Place it on level ground with easy truck access.
  2. Load heavy items first, then lighter debris.
  3. Do not overfill above the bin edge.
  4. Keep restricted items separate.
  5. Schedule pickup before the bin is overflowing.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I know what size dumpster I need?

Match the dumpster size to your project. A small bathroom remodel may need a 10-yard bin, while a full house renovation could require a 30-yard or larger.

Can I throw concrete or dirt in a dumpster?

Yes, but only certain bins are designed for heavy waste. Always confirm with your rental company.

How long can I keep the dumpster?

Most rentals allow 7–10 days. If you need more time, ask about daily or weekly extensions.

Do I need to be home for delivery?

No, as long as the placement spot is clear and accessible.

What happens if I overfill the dumpster?

Overfilled dumpsters may not be picked up for safety reasons, and you may be charged extra.
